Gandhinagar, Jan. 12 -- India and Germany on Monday finalised a set of agreements across a wide range of sectors, including defence, technology, health, energy and human resources, during German Chancellor Friedrich Merz's two-day official visit to India.
The Ministry of External Affairs said the two sides concluded 19 agreements and announced several measures to intensify engagement across strategic, economic and people-to-people pillars.
One of the key outcomes was a Joint Declaration of Intent to boost bilateral defence industrial cooperation.
